Information Regulator

The Information Regulator of South Africa is an independent body established in terms of section 39 of the Protection of Personal Information Act 4 of 2013. It is subject only to the law and the Constitution and it is accountable to the National Assembly. The Information Regulator is, among others, empowered to monitor and enforce compliance by public and private bodies with the provisions of the Promotion of Access to Information Act, 2000 (act 2 of 2000), and the Protection of Personal Information Act, 2013 (act 4 of 2013).
